titleOfInvention | Fiber glass sizing compositions, sized glass fibers and methods for their use |
abstract | (57) [Summary]nProvided is an aqueous glass fiber sizing composition that enhances whiteness and imparts high wet-out and wet-through to composites made using glass fibers coated with the sizing composition of the present invention. When used to reinforce thermoset polymeric materials, glass fibers sized with the composition provide composites with a more uniform surface with reduced fiber protrusion, fiber lead-through, and wave. It causes damage due to unevenness, warpage or aggregation. The composition comprises a urethane modified epoxy thermosetting copolymer; a self-reactive crosslinkable copolymer selected from vinyl acetate polymers, polyesters, acrylic polymers and mixtures thereof; a thermoplastic polymer; at least one organofunctional silane coupling agent. A filling lubricant; and a sufficient amount of water to apply the sizing composition to at least one glass fiber. |
